Nature’s Playground: South Mountain Park
First up, you can’t talk about Ahwatukee without mentioning South Mountain Park, one of the largest municipal parks in the United States. Spanning over 16,000 acres, it’s a paradise for hikers, bikers, and horseback riders. With miles of trails winding through stunning desert landscapes, you can choose from easy strolls to challenging hikes. The views from the top are nothing short of spectacular, especially at sunset when the sky bursts into colors that would make a painter jealous. A Taste of Local Culture
Check out the Ahwatukee Farmers Market if you’re in the mood for something more cultural. This market is a feast for the senses, held every Sunday at the Ahwatukee Community Swim and Tennis Center. You’ll find everything from fresh produce to unique local crafts. Grab some homemade salsa or a loaf of artisan bread, and enjoy a leisurely afternoon. It’s the perfect way to mingle with locals and soak up the community spirit.
For those who love a bit of drama, the Ahwatukee Nutcracker Ballet is a seasonal treat that showcases local talent. With around 100 dancers and a dazzling array of costumes, this performance brings the holiday spirit to life. It’s a delightful way to get into the festive mood and support the arts in your community.
Foodie Heaven
Ahwatukee is also a foodie’s paradise. Start your culinary adventure at Pomegranate Cafe, which has earned accolades for its delicious vegan menu. From Mediterranean wraps to raw tacos, there’s something to satisfy every palate. If you want something sweet, swing by Nothing Bundt Cakes for a slice of their famous bundt cakes. With flavors ranging from red velvet to white chocolate raspberry, you’ll leave with a smile and possibly a few crumbs on your shirt.
For a casual dining experience, head over to Rustler’s Rooste, an Old West-style restaurant where you can slide into your seat on a stainless-steel slide. The steaks are juicy, and the city lights’ views at night are breathtaking. Don’t forget to try their signature dessert, the “cow pie,” which is as delightful as it sounds!
